My Project
My children need a sand and water table. This table will help the children with math, science, language and socialization skills. The children will be able to practice pouring, measure and weighing with water and sand. They will learn to work together in small groups.
You will make it possible for children to learn key math concepts through hands-on activities.
It is essential in Pre-K that children learn with their hands. Thank you for taking the time to read my proposal.
